I have mold in my attic, but my roof doesn't leak. What's wrong?

Attic mold typically indicates a ventilation failure, not a leak. On an 8/12 steep gable roof, proper airflow is critical. The 2021 IRC with PA amendments mandates a balanced system of intake (soffit) and exhaust (ridge or gable) vents. An imbalanced system allows hot, moist air from the house to stagnate in the attic, condensing on the cold underside of the roof deck in winter. This chronic moisture promotes wood rot and mold growth on the plank decking itself.

What makes a roof 'storm-ready' for our area?

Storm readiness is defined by engineering for local hazards. Mount Pleasant's 115 mph wind zone requires enhanced shingle attachment and high-wind rated components. For hail, which poses a moderate risk here, installing Class 4 impact-resistant shingles is a financial necessity. These shingles resist damage from 1.0-inch hailstones common in our peak severe thunderstorm season, preventing granular loss and fractures that lead to leaks and costly insurance claims after a storm.

My roof looks fine from the ground. Do I still need an inspection?

Visual inspections often miss critical failure points. We use infrared thermal moisture mapping to detect sub-surface water retention and thermal anomalies within the architectural asphalt shingle layers and the wood decking below. This technology identifies trapped moisture from minor leaks or condensation long before it causes visible ceiling stains or rot, allowing for targeted repairs that preserve the structure and prevent more extensive, costly damage.

What are the current code requirements for a roof replacement?

All work must comply with the 2021 IRC, as amended by the Pennsylvania Uniform Construction Code. This requires a permit from the Mount Pleasant Borough Building & Zoning Department. Key 2026 specifics include ice and water shield extending 24 inches inside the interior wall line and properly integrated step and head wall flashing. Your contractor must also be registered with the Pennsylvania Attorney General's Office as a Home Improvement Contractor, which provides you with vital consumer protections.
